Выборка по первой букве (умляуту) не работает

Статус
В этой теме нельзя размещать новые ответы.

Maler

Новичок
Выборка по первой букве (умляуту) не работает

Приветствую

Есть таблица из которой нужно выбрать все поля (utf_generl_ci), запись в которых начинается с символов Ä Å Ö, но база воспринимает эти буквы как Ä=А Å=А Ö=О.
Подскажите, что делать.

Спасибо!
 

Maler

Новичок
спасибо за наводку, а если по русски?

-~{}~ 09.10.08 17:13:

*****
пример можете дать, что-то я не могу разобраться
 

Maler

Новичок
Кусок кода php и я буду вам очень благодарен!

-~{}~ 09.10.08 17:42:

я это делаю так я это делаю так LIKE '$chr%' COLLATE 'latin1_swedish_ci' и вообще ничего не выдает.

-~{}~ 09.10.08 17:52:

я изменил кодировку поля на latin1_swedish_ci, но при этом не работает полнотекстовый поиск
 

Maler

Новичок
в одном поле русский (utf8) в другом финский (latin1)

-~{}~ 09.10.08 18:44:

вопрос решен, тему можно закрывать.. коллайшан не пригодился
 

Maler

Новичок
тебе это интересно, или ты такой же советчик как и товарищи выше?
 

zerkms

TDD infected
Команда форума
Maler
это хороший тон в любых сообществах. если ты просишь, чтобы тебе помогли, но сам находишь решение раньше - пость найденное, дабы помочь тем, кто, возможно, столкнётся с аналогичной проблемой позже
 

Фанат

oncle terrible
Команда форума
В данном случае врядли имеет смысл так уж выспрашивать.
там binary, или еще какой костыль.
 

Maler

Новичок
zerkms
я полностью с тобой согласен! Но увы, обратившись с вопросом, я получил не ответ, а тычок носом в кучу г.. (иди мол, почитай маны, лентяй).
Если мне нужно получить ответ, я задаю вопрос в тематических сообществах, в данном случае, мне нужен был ответ для быстрого решения задачи.. но увы, я его не получил.


А решение было простым, перевести поля из utf8_general_ci в utf8_swedish_ci. По скольку полнотекстовый поиск мне в данном конкретном случае не нужен, то решение с LIKE подходит. В случае, если нужен полнотекстовый поиск, то тут решение мне неизвестно, но если мне это решение понадобится, обращаться на этот форум я точно не стану!

П.С.
Хотел сказать грубость, но не буду.
 

Maler

Новичок
*****
читай внимательнее, я не называл ман кучей г., это относится к "почитай маны, лентяй".

"там binary, или еще какой костыль" вот это ответ так ответ, исчерпывающий! За таким ответом, определенно стоило сюда писать.
 

Фанат

oncle terrible
Команда форума
там binary, или еще какой костыль - это был не ответ.
фразу "почитай маны" ты считаешь тыканьем в кучу г.
не стоит этого делать.

если тебе здесь не нравится - тебя здесь никто не держит.
всего хорошего
 
Статус
В этой теме нельзя размещать новые ответы.
Сверху